Biography

Barry Cooper is a Professor of Music at the University of Manchester, England, UK. He is best known for his research on Beethoven and has previously published or edited ten books on the composer. He has also published scholarly performing editions of Beethoven’s 35 piano sonatas and other works, and his completion of the first movement of Beethoven’s unfinished Tenth Symphony has been performed worldwide.
